Why Craigslist Sacramento Remains a Goldmine for Used Cars
In an era dominated by slick, specialized car-buying apps and large dealership websites, you might wonder why Craigslist still merits attention. The answer lies in its raw, unfiltered nature and the unique advantages it offers, especially for finding "used cars Sacramento Craigslist."
Firstly, Craigslist offers unparalleled local reach. When you search for "Craigslist Cars Sac," you’re directly tapping into the local private seller market, which is often where the best deals are hidden. These aren’t professional dealerships with overheads to cover; they’re individuals looking to sell their personal vehicles, often at more flexible prices.
Secondly, the diversity of listings is truly astounding. From daily commuters to vintage projects, family SUVs to work trucks, the range of vehicles available on Craigslist Sacramento cars is vast. This platform is a testament to the diverse needs and interests of the Sacramento populace, ensuring there’s something for almost everyone.
Finally, and perhaps most importantly, Craigslist fosters direct communication. You’re speaking directly with the car’s owner, allowing you to ask detailed questions, understand the vehicle’s history from a personal perspective, and build rapport before even seeing the car. This direct line of communication is invaluable for gathering crucial information and assessing the seller’s transparency.
Mastering Your Search: Finding the Best Craigslist Cars Sac
Effective searching is the cornerstone of a successful Craigslist car hunt. It’s not just about typing "cars for sale"; it’s about intelligent filtering and understanding the nuances of the platform. Based on my experience, a well-executed search can save you hours of sifting through irrelevant listings.
Start with broad terms like "Craigslist Cars Sac" or "used cars Sacramento Craigslist," but then immediately refine your search. Use the filters provided: price range, make, model, year, and even mileage. Be realistic about your budget and needs, but also keep an open mind for slightly outside-the-box options that might offer better value.
Pro tips from us: Always use keywords like "clean title," "one owner," or "low mileage" in your search. These terms often indicate a more desirable vehicle and can quickly narrow down your options. Also, try searching for common misspellings of popular car models; you might find a hidden gem that others missed.
Crafting the Perfect Inquiry
Once you spot a promising listing, your initial contact with the seller is crucial. A well-crafted email or text message can set you apart and encourage a prompt, informative response. Avoid generic inquiries like "Is this still available?"
Instead, introduce yourself briefly, mention specific details from their listing to show you’ve read it thoroughly, and ask one or two pointed questions. For instance, "I’m interested in your 2015 Honda Civic. Could you tell me more about its maintenance history, and when might you be available for a viewing?" This approach demonstrates seriousness and respect for their time.
Safety First: Navigating the Sacramento Private Sale Landscape Securely
The direct nature of Craigslist comes with an inherent responsibility to prioritize your safety. While the vast majority of transactions are legitimate, common mistakes to avoid include rushing into meetings or ignoring your gut feelings. Your personal safety and financial security are paramount when dealing with "Craigslist Cars Sac."
Always arrange to meet sellers in a well-lit, public location during daylight hours. Consider busy shopping center parking lots, police station parking lots, or even local coffee shops. Avoid secluded areas or meeting at a seller’s home for the first interaction, especially if you’re going alone.
Bring a friend or family member with you for added security. A second pair of eyes can also be helpful for inspecting the car and noticing details you might miss. Inform someone else of your meeting details, including the time, location, and the seller’s contact information.
When it comes to test drives, never hand over your driver’s license or car keys to the seller. You should always be the one driving during a test drive. If the seller insists on driving, politely decline or suggest a different arrangement. Ensure the car is insured for test drives, which is typically covered by your existing auto insurance policy, but it’s always wise to confirm.
The Ultimate Used Car Inspection Checklist for Craigslist Buyers
Once you’ve found a promising "Craigslist Cars Sac" listing and arranged a safe meeting, the real detective work begins. A thorough inspection is non-negotiable. Don’t just kick the tires; delve into every aspect of the vehicle.
Here’s a detailed checklist to guide your inspection, ensuring you uncover any potential issues before making a commitment:
Exterior Examination:
- Body Panels: Look for inconsistencies in paint color, dents, scratches, or signs of rust. Check panel gaps; uneven gaps can indicate previous accident repairs.
- Tires: Inspect tire tread depth and look for uneven wear, which could signal alignment issues. Check the brand and age of the tires.
- Lights & Glass: Test all exterior lights (headlights, tail lights, turn signals, brake lights). Look for cracks or chips in the windshield, mirrors, and windows.
- Under the Hood: Check fluid levels (oil, coolant, brake fluid). Look for leaks, frayed belts, or corroded battery terminals. Ensure hoses are pliable, not cracked.
Interior Assessment:
- Upholstery: Look for rips, tears, stains, or excessive wear.
- Electronics: Test all power windows, locks, radio, AC/heater, and dashboard lights.
- Odors: Pay attention to any unusual smells like mildew, burning oil, or smoke, which can indicate underlying problems or a history of smoking.
- Pedals: Excessive wear on the brake or accelerator pedals can sometimes indicate higher mileage than what’s shown on the odometer.
The Test Drive:
- Starting: Listen for any unusual noises when starting the engine.
- Acceleration: Does the car accelerate smoothly? Any hesitation or unusual noises?
- Braking: Test the brakes at various speeds. Does the car pull to one side? Any grinding or squealing?
- Steering: Does the steering feel tight and responsive, or loose and vague?
- Suspension: Drive over bumps and listen for clunks or squeaks.
- Transmission: Pay attention to how the transmission shifts. Is it smooth or jerky?
Beyond the Visual: Documentation and Professional Review
Always request to see the car’s title to confirm the seller is the legal owner. Cross-reference the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) on the title with the VIN on the car itself (usually on the dashboard and door jamb). This is a critical step to avoid fraudulent sales.
Pro Tip: Insist on a vehicle history report from a reputable service like CarFax or AutoCheck. While these cost money, they provide invaluable insights into accidents, service history, title issues (like salvage or flood titles), and odometer discrepancies. This small investment can save you from a major financial headache.
Based on my experience, even after your thorough inspection, it’s always wise to arrange a pre-purchase inspection (PPI) by an independent, trusted mechanic. This small cost (typically $100-$200) can uncover hidden mechanical issues that even an experienced buyer might miss. It provides peace of mind and often gives you leverage in negotiation. If the seller refuses a PPI, consider that a major red flag.
Sealing the Deal: Negotiation, Paperwork, and Payment for Your Craigslist Car
You’ve found the perfect car, completed your inspections, and are ready to make an offer. This final stage requires careful negotiation and meticulous attention to legal details.
The Art of Negotiation:
- Be Prepared: Research the car’s market value using sites like Kelley Blue Book (KBB) or Edmunds. This gives you a strong basis for your offer.
- Be Polite, But Firm: Start with a fair but slightly lower offer than your target price, leaving room to negotiate upwards. Highlight any minor flaws you found during your inspection to justify your offer.
- Walk Away if Necessary: Be prepared to walk away if the seller isn’t willing to meet a reasonable price. There are always other "Craigslist Cars Sac" listings.
Handling the Paperwork:
- Vehicle Ensure the title is clear (not a salvage or lien title) and signed over correctly by the seller. Verify that the VIN on the title matches the car.
- Bill of Sale: Always create a Bill of Sale, even if not legally required in California. This document protects both buyer and seller. It should include:
- Buyer and seller names and addresses.
- Vehicle make, model, year, and VIN.
- Purchase price.
- Date of sale.
- A statement that the vehicle is sold "as-is" (unless otherwise agreed).
- Signatures of both parties.
You can find templates online or at your local DMV. For detailed information on California-specific requirements, consult the official California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) website.
Secure Payment Methods:
- Cashier’s Check/Bank Transfer: For larger sums, a cashier’s check from a reputable bank or a direct bank transfer are the safest options. Arrange to complete this transaction at your bank, where you can verify funds and prevent fraud.
- Cash: For smaller amounts, cash can be acceptable, but always handle it discreetly and in a safe, public place. Avoid carrying large sums of cash.
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Buying Craigslist Cars Sac
Having guided many through the used car buying process, I’ve seen my share of missteps. Avoiding these common pitfalls can save you significant time, money, and stress.
One of the biggest mistakes is skipping the pre-purchase inspection. Thinking you can save a hundred dollars by not getting a mechanic to look at the car is often a false economy. That overlooked issue could cost you thousands down the line.
Another frequent error is not verifying the seller’s identity and ownership. Always check the seller’s ID against the name on the title. Common scams involve individuals trying to sell a car they don’t legally own or one with a problematic title.
Finally, succumbing to pressure tactics is a common pitfall. If a seller is overly aggressive, rushes you, or creates a sense of urgency, take a step back. A legitimate sale doesn’t require high-pressure tactics. Trust your instincts; if something feels off, it probably is.
Beyond the Purchase: Your First Steps as a New Car Owner in Sacramento
Congratulations! You’ve successfully navigated the world of "Craigslist Cars Sac" and are now the proud owner of a new-to-you vehicle. But your journey isn’t quite over. There are a few crucial steps to take immediately after the purchase to ensure a smooth transition.
Registration and Title Transfer:
In California, you typically have 10 days from the date of purchase to transfer the vehicle’s title into your name. Head to your local DMV office with the signed-over title, bill of sale, and proof of insurance. Be prepared for potential fees, including sales tax and registration fees.
Auto Insurance:
Before you even drive the car off the seller’s property, ensure you have active auto insurance coverage. In California, it’s illegal to drive without it. Contact your insurance provider immediately after the purchase to add the new vehicle to your policy.
Initial Maintenance:
Even if the car passed its pre-purchase inspection, it’s a good practice to perform some basic maintenance. This includes changing the oil and filter, checking all fluids, and inspecting the air filter. This gives you a fresh baseline for your maintenance schedule.

Exploring Alternatives to Craigslist in Sacramento
While Craigslist is an excellent resource, it’s not the only game in town for finding used cars in Sacramento. Exploring alternatives can broaden your options and sometimes offer different buying experiences.
- Dealerships: Reputable used car dealerships offer peace of mind through certified pre-owned programs, warranties, and financing options. While prices might be higher, the added security can be worth it for some.
- Online Marketplaces: Websites like AutoTrader, Edmunds, and CarGurus aggregate listings from both dealerships and private sellers, offering a more structured search experience.
- Social Media Marketplaces: Facebook Marketplace has emerged as a significant player in the used car market, offering a similar private seller experience to Craigslist but often with more detailed seller profiles.
- Local Auctions: Public auto auctions, though riskier, can offer significant savings for those with mechanical knowledge and a willingness to take a gamble.
